Ljalja Kuznetsova - Gypsies, Free spirits of The Open Steppe - 1998

USSR gypsies by Soviet photographer Ljalja Kuznetsova

Ljalja Kuznetsova was a participant of the legendary group “TASMA”. Since the mid-80s her works have been exhibited and published in the US and Europe, including the gallery of Art in Washington.
Awards:
Leica Medal of Excellence 1997
Grand Prix of the City of Paris

Together with Koudelka's volume of the same name, this book represents the most important photographic publication on gypsies, focusing on the Stan populations of the former Soviet area. An unmissable book for lovers of the genre.

Ljalja Kuznetsova: Gypsies, Free spirits of The Open Steppe
First Edition 1998 Hardback in dust jacket

This collection of photographs reveal a Russia most Westerners do not know, or might not believe still exists.

Children playing on the tombs of a graveyard; families and friends gathering around a meal in scenes reminiscent of Brueghel's opulent paintings, gypsies preparing for festivities or rituals, posing, dancing or laughing.

For the last 15 years Ljalja Kuznetsova has been documenting the people of her country with compassion and an understanding of their spirit.

Her photographs of her from the Ukraine, Odessa, Kazan, Usbekistan and Turkmenistan bring to life the place and its people of her.

She 38she tells of myth and history, providing stories of humour, pride, and fortitude of character that has survived the cultural turmoil in the Soviet Union, and will hopefully resist the ongoing pressure in the changing Russian confederation.
